JL MERROW is that rare beast, an English person who refuses to drink tea. She read Natural Sciences at Cambridge, where she learned many things, chief amongst which was that she never wanted to see the inside of a lab ever again. Her one regret is that she never mastered the ability of punting one-handed whilst holding a glass of champagne.She writes across genres, with a preference for contemporary gay romance and mysteries, and is frequently accused of humour. - Rating: 4 out of 5 stars4/5Tip has been cursed by a witch to turn into a tortoise, mostly at inopportune times. He is tortoise-napped by a little old lady. Trying to escape her, he finds the most exquisite man ever who reads the same authors. Will he run when Tip turns into a human? Why was he tortoise-napped?I enjoyed this short story. It was funny. I would like to see it developed into a longer tale or this be the prequel to a novel on Tip and Steve. It was sweet. Poor Tip! He is lost as to what happens to him and when. He knows the why. I liked Steve trying to reassure Tip as to why he was tortoist-napped. This story made me feel good and that's okay for a rainy day.
